One we tried out recently is Sites in VR. I recently ordered Baofeng Small Mojing virtual reality headset from AliExpress. They start at $12, with free shipping, and come in a variety of colors. #QR CODE FOR SYBOL COLORCROSS VIRTUAL REALITY FREE# Unfortunately, they did not come with a Google Cardboard QR code. This is a symbol that you use to calibrate your headset, so that Google Cardboard virtual reality apps and YouTube movies show up as best as possible. Google, unfortunately, was not my friend - apparently, this particular QR code had not yet been uploaded by anyone.īut I’m not someone who’s just willing to sit around and wait for other people to do the work. Especially when I can get a blog post out of it. And there’s a QR Code Generator that Google has created for folks to use. Of course, this generator is designed to be used by the manufacturers themselves, but it turned out that it wasn’t too difficult for a mere human to do it, either. Getting started with the Viewer Profile Generator. I loaded up the official website on my computer, then picked up my smartphone - a Samsung Galaxy S6, pulled up a QR code reader app, and scanned the QR code. Or you could also type in the URL provided. It opened up a tool on my smartphone that is synched with the form on my computer screen. The phone loaded the tool and asked me for the “pixels per inch” value of my device. I Googled “samsung galaxy s6 pixels per inch” and got 577. It asked me to touch the screen to switch to full-screen view, then I got a bunch of lines on the screen. I skipped the part about adding my company name and device name, since I’m not the actual manufacturer - and I still have hopes that the manufacturer themselves will come through and create an official code.
